Harrisburg, Pa. – The Center for Innovation & Entrepreneurship(CIE) powered by Harrisburg University of Science and Technology will officially open in its new space, the Entrepreneurship Center in Strawberry Square, during a ribbon cutting celebration set for 3 p.m. on March 15.

The center is home to 11 startup founders enrolled in its business incubator program, which is comprised of 80 percent Black, Indigenous, People of Color (BIPOC)-owned and 50 percent women-owned businesses. The new space offers founders—the entrepreneurs who are invited into the incubator—residency to develop their business ideas for up to 18 months, financial assistance, coaching, and student interns.

“Economic development and support for businesses have always been part of HU’s mission,” said Dr. Eric Darr, Harrisburg University President. “The center is accessible and for anyone who has an idea. It can be anybody who just has a concept but doesn’t know where to start. We hope, by having founders come to the Entrepreneurship Center, it creates new companies and jobs throughout the Harrisburg region and beyond,”

CIE Executive Director Jay Jayamohan and his network of entrepreneurs and innovators mentor the incubator’s founders in the center. They help them form corporations and connect them with funding resources. They help them find pro-bono attorneys for their intellectual property and help them flesh out ideas. They provide support staff. They connect them with technology and software development partners, and more.

“The multi-faceted goal of CIE is not only flipping the script on what you must “look like” to be an innovator, but to build a replicable model to create a positive economic change in small cities and towns,” Jayamohan said. “This will not happen without the support of the larger community and so we are excited for our new space and have entrepreneurs and innovators from the community continue to be an evangelist for the work we do.”

ABOUT CIE

The Center for Innovation & Entrepreneurship’s (CIE) mission is to empower innovators to build successful ventures by providing the infrastructure and resources, with a special focus on serving the underrepresented minority. Unlike other programs focusing on pie-in-the sky pitches delivered over an accelerator program, we provide the support and infrastructure to build his/her idea in a thoughtful way with the guidance of the right kind of experienced entrepreneurs.
